Keshwada From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Keshwada is a small provincial state near Rajkot, Gujarat,[1] which was one of the many states ruled by Ra Naghan the forefather of the clans of Chudasama, Sarvaiya, and Raijada. ↑ "Primary Census Abstract Data Tables – India: Final Population Totals".
